Improper representation of the company will invalidate the contract
According to legal regulations, it is permissible to conclude a contract between a limited liability company and a member of its management board. They may, for example, rent real estate owned by them to the company. Who should represent the company in such cases to ensure validity of the contract?
In today's edition of Dziennik Gazeta Prawna we can find an article by Marcin Borkowski, PhD., GWW of counsel.
